First, check for any type of existing damage prior to the cool sets in. Seek missing shingles, splits, or leakages; resolving these concerns now can conserve you from expensive repair work later.
Next off, consider the weight of snow. Buildup can cause drooping or even architectural failing. If you reside in a region prone to heavy snowfall, it's wise to purchase a roofing rake. On a regular basis removing snow off your roofing helps prevent these issues.
After that, concentrate on your seamless gutters. Blocked seamless gutters can bring about ice dams, triggering water to support and possibly seep into your home. Guarantee your gutters are tidy and without particles to advertise correct water drainage.
Lastly, inspect your attic room for correct insulation and air flow. A well-insulated attic room aids protect against heat loss, reducing the opportunities of ice formation on your roof covering.
Springtime Maintenance Essentials
After wintertime's rough hold loosens, it's time to provide your roof covering some interest.
Spring is the ideal period for a comprehensive evaluation to ensure your roof is ready for the warmer months ahead. Start by checking for any noticeable damage, like missing shingles or cracked ceramic tiles. If you find any type of problems, address them quickly to prevent leakages.
Next off, eliminate debris, such as fallen leaves and branches, that might have collected on your roof and in your seamless gutters.
Stopped up rain gutters can bring about water pooling, which can harm your roof and home's structure. Cleansing them out will help route water flow and protect your property.
Analyze your roofing system's blinking and seals around chimneys and vents. If they look worn or damaged, re-caulking might be required to keep a water tight seal.
Finally, think about scheduling a specialist inspection. A professional can identify possible concerns you could miss out on and offer recommendations tailored to your roofing system type.
